#!/usr/bin/env python3 ''' Extension for InkScape 1.0 Features - This tool is a helper to adjust the document border including an offset value, which is added. Sending vector data to Epilog Dashboard often results in trimmed paths. This leads to wrong geometry where the laser misses to cut them. So we add a default (small) amount of 1.0 doc units to expand the document's canvas Author: Mario Voigt / FabLab Chemnitz Mail: mario.voigt@stadtfabrikanten.org Date: 21.04.2021 Last patch: 21.04.2021 License: GNU GPL v3 ''' import inkex from inkex import Transform class BBoxAdjust(inkex.EffectExtension): def effect(self): offset = 1.0 #in documents' units # create a new bounding box and get the bbox size of all elements of the document (we cannot use the page's bbox) bbox = inkex.BoundingBox() for element in self.svg.root.getchildren(): if isinstance (element, inkex.ShapeElement): bbox += element.bounding_box() # adjust the viewBox to the bbox size and add the desired offset self.document.getroot().attrib['viewBox'] = f'{-offset} {-offset} {bbox.width + offset * 2} {bbox.height + offset * 2}' self.document.getroot().attrib['width'] = f'{bbox.width + offset * 2}' + self.svg.unit self.document.getroot().attrib['height'] = f'{bbox.height + offset * 2}' + self.svg.unit # translate all elements to fit the adjusted viewBox mat = Transform("translate(%f, %f)" % (-bbox.left,-bbox.top)).matrix for element in self.svg.root.getchildren(): if isinstance (element, inkex.ShapeElement): element.transform = Transform(mat) * element.transform if __name__ == '__main__': BBoxAdjust().run()
